Output 01e94637867d5c8a2fec8c36091fc617320b75d58431f7737289e7609e1e7e37:0

value
32584383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27f1a7e7015ee02b589e34903d15a7d06b01764c OP_EQUALVERIFY OP_CHECKSIG
address
14eCr2UmV95sYmdRSp7WgAVeUV12Xpqb8B
transaction
01e94637867d5c8a2fec8c36091fc617320b75d58431f7737289e7609e1e7e37
confirmations
579364
spent
true